
Eve Deng enhanced the Business Registry Dashboard in the bcgov/business-dashboard-ui repository by delivering two features focused on user experience and code maintainability. She improved the delete draft modal, refining its wording and structure to provide clearer guidance and consistency for users during draft deletion. Using Vue.js and TypeScript, Eve also applied ESLint-driven code cleanups across multiple components, removing unused imports and improving readability. She stabilized Cypress end-to-end tests by aligning them with updated dialog behaviors, reducing test flakiness and supporting faster release cycles. Her work emphasized quality-focused refactoring, laying a foundation for smoother future enhancements and reduced technical debt.
